RMAN备份保留与control_file_record_keep_time之间的关系

适用版本:Version 8.1.7.0 and later


在控制文件的重用部分中,保留有RMAN备份的备份元数据。保留多久取决于CONTROL_FILE_RECORD_KEEP_TIME。此参数指明了在数据文件中重用信息元数据所能保留的最小天数。

场景:一条记录需要插到控制文件的重用部分,但是重用部分那里没有足够的空间了,那么,那条时间最久远的记录将被删除。


备份保留策略,是用以满足在恢复或者有其他需要的时候,拥有足够备份的一个规则。所以如果CONTROL_FILE_RECORD_KEEP_TIME的值较保留策略小,那么就会在RMAN没有废弃(obsolete)这些备份之前重写这些备份的元数据信息。因此,CONTROL_FILE_RECORD_KEEP_TIME建议设置一个大于保留策略的值。



建议:

CONTROL_FILE_RECORD_KEEP_TIME = retention period + level 0 backup interval + 1


注:

obsolete:是超出retention policy时间的备份

expired:是不存在的文件。

你可能感兴趣的:(RMAN备份保留与control_file_record_keep_time之间的关系)